What affects the price

When planning a hardscape project, several factors influence your final investment. The total square footage is the primary driver, but the complexity of the design—such as curves, patterns, or multi-level tiers—adds to labor time. Site accessibility matters too; if crews need specialized equipment to move materials into a tight backyard, that affects the bottom line. Material choice, from standard concrete blocks to premium natural stone, significantly shifts the budget. Additionally, your current ground condition determines how much excavation and base preparation is required for long-term stability.

An awning is a retractable or fixed fabric cover that extends from your home's exterior wall to shade a portion of your patio. You need one when you want adjustable shade that can be tucked away when you prefer full sun. They are great for managing indoor temperatures as well by blocking light from sliding glass doors. Is it cheaper to lay concrete or pavers?

The initial cost can vary, with concrete sometimes appearing cheaper upfront for a basic slab in Santa Rosa. However, pavers offer greater long-term value due to their durability and repairability. If a section of pavers cracks or sinks, it can be individually replaced, unlike a concrete slab. This can save money over time, especially considering the varying soil conditions around Santa Rosa.

Do I really need sand under pavers?

Yes, a layer of paver base and then a bedding sand layer is crucial for a stable paver installation in Santa Rosa. This sand layer allows for minor adjustments and provides a smooth surface for laying the pavers. Without it, your patio or driveway can become uneven, and water drainage issues can arise, especially with the seasonal rains here.

What is meant by hardscaping?

Hardscaping refers to the non-living elements of your landscape design. This includes patios, walkways, driveways, retaining walls, and outdoor kitchens. In Santa Rosa, it's about building functional and beautiful structures that enhance your property's usability and curb appeal. Think of it as the solid framework for your outdoor living space.

What is an example of hardscaping?

A classic example of hardscaping in Santa Rosa is a custom-designed paver patio extending from your home, perfect for entertaining. Another is a sturdy retaining wall built to manage a slope in your yard, or a winding flagstone pathway leading through your garden. Even a well-constructed outdoor fireplace or a built-in BBQ area falls under the umbrella of hardscaping.
